Commission On Human Rights

Authority

Board of Supervisors: Ordinance #4625.

Duties

The purpose of the Commission is to promote better human relations among all people in Sonoma County through education, mediation, cooperation with County and community agencies, and by initiating action that fosters the recognition of and an appreciation for the cultural diversity of the community.

Term

Two years.

Membership Composition

Fifteen members, three appointed by each Supervisor.

Contacts

Dell Jacoby - (707) 565-2317.

Meeting Schedule

Fourth Tuesday of each month - 5:30 p.m. - Permit and Resource Management meeting room, 2550 Ventura Ave., Santa Rosa.
